PerfEvent counter configuration.
PerfKvmCounterConfig & samplePeriod(uint64_t period)
Set the initial sample period (overflow count) of an event.
struct perf_event_attr attr
Underlying perf_event_attr structure describing the counter.
PerfKvmCounterConfig & disabled(bool val)
Don't start the performance counter automatically when attaching it.
PerfKvmCounterConfig & exclude_host(bool val)
Exclude the events from the host (i.e., only include events from the guest system).
PerfKvmCounterConfig & exclude_hv(bool val)
Exclude the hyper visor (i.e., only include events from the guest system).
PerfKvmCounterConfig & pinned(bool val)
Force the group to be on the active all the time (i.e., disallow multiplexing).
PerfKvmCounterConfig & wakeupEvents(uint32_t events)
Set the number of samples that need to be triggered before reporting data as being available on the p...
PerfKvmCounterConfig(uint32_t type, uint64_t config)
Initialize PerfEvent counter configuration structure.
